BL seems to be retaining everything I sell that have sold-out of
into my stockroom (even if that part is not marked to be retained).

Is anyone else experiencing this issue? Thanks!

In a past thread, someone gave an explanation of why this happens. I don't
recall the details, but something to do with the buyer making changes somewhere
in the order process. Nothing the seller can do to prevent it. It seems to
happen to me about once every 100 orders where every single item in that order
will end up with 0 quantity and be in the stockroom (assuming they bought out
the whole lot). I don't recall what happens if they don't buy the whole
lot, but I think it behaves correctly. I haven't noticed it ever clear on
its own, but whenever I check, I go ahead and delete the entries from the stockroom
manually.

This is annoying, but at least it's better than how it used to behave. About
3 years ago, it would just not deduct what was purchased from your inventory,
so I would occasionally have people order items that had already sold. I'd
find that earlier order, and sure enough, every item from that order was off
on its quantity.
